Andrew Burton decides to fly himself to Egypt to capture the action, despite the lack of financial support from any of his future publisher(s):
My flight to Egypt was a self funded trip that was equal parts me learning the ropes, and me trying to document what I find to be an incredibly important news story. I have no interest in portraying myself as something I’m not — this is my first real step into conflict (whatever you want to call it) photography. […] This blog will end up being some sort of public diary showing the learning curve I am going through as I learn how to handle situations like this — in my writing, I have decided I’m going to be totally honest about my fears, train of thought, and the lessons I learn along the way.
